摘要: 植物展览温室是高能耗建筑,尤其是建造在严寒地区的温室,更加需要采用多种有效手段尽可能降低能耗,同时还必须满足植物的生长和人员的基本舒适性需求。以黑瞎子岛北大荒现代生态园为例,从围护结构,冷热源系统,散热器强化传热措施和不同季节通风方式的角度,探讨了严寒地区植物展览温室的暖通设计要点。。

关键词: 严寒地区植物温室, 围护结构, 散热器强化换热措施, 风系统

Abstract: The greenhouse is a high energy construction, especially in cold area.It needs to adopt a variety of effective ways to reduce energy consumption as much as possible,and also must satisfy the needs of the plant growth and basic requirements for the staff. This paper introduces in detail the key points of HVAC design of a greenhouse in cold area,from the enclosure structure,heating and cooling system,heat transfer enhancement of radiator and ventilation of different seasons,take the Heixiazi Botanical Garden as an example.

Key words: greenhouse in cold area, enclosure structure, heat transfer enhancement of radiator, ventilation system
